However, if they are all properly set up, It could be that your other office is experiencing a browser related-problem. This why there are missing sub-customers when converting to a project.
We can use a private or incognito window to confirm this issue. You can follow these keyboard shortcut keys below based on the regular browser you used:
- Google Chrome: Ctrl + Shift + N
- Mozilla Firefox: Ctrl + Shift + P
- Safari: Command + Option + P
If you're able to see the missing sub-customers now, they'll need to troubleshoot their main browser. I'd recommend following the steps in this help article: Clear browser cache. This will help prevent unusual behavior to the browser. If the same thing happen, I suggest using another supported and updated web browser.
